Lakshya Sen Advances to Second Round of Malaysia Open, Ayush Shetty Also Registers Impressive Win

Punjab Newsline, Sports: 

Lakshya defeats Singapore’s Jia Heng Jason Teh, Ayush Shetty beats Malaysia’s Lee Zii Jia in straight games

Indian badminton star Lakshya Sen made a strong start to the new season by advancing to the second round of the Malaysia Open Super 1000 tournament in men’s singles. In a first-round match played on Tuesday, Lakshya defeated Singapore’s Jia Heng Jason Teh in a hard-fought encounter to secure his place in the next round. The match lasted nearly 70 minutes, during which Lakshya overcame the world No. 21 Teh with a scoreline of 21-16, 15-21, 21-14.

The contest witnessed intense competition right from the beginning, with both players displaying high-quality badminton. Lakshya started confidently in the opening game, using his attacking skills and court coverage effectively to take control and win the game 21-16. In the second game, Teh made a strong comeback, capitalising on a few unforced errors by Lakshya and playing with greater aggression to clinch the game 21-15, leveling the match.

In the deciding third game, Lakshya Sen showed his experience and composure. He maintained consistency in rallies, won crucial points at key moments, and gradually pulled away from his opponent. Lakshya sealed the decider 21-14 to wrap up the match and move into the second round of the prestigious tournament.

The 24-year-old Lakshya Sen has been in good form over the past year. In the previous season, he won the Australian Open title and also reached the final of the Hong Kong Open. A bronze medallist at the 2021 World Championships, Lakshya is currently ranked 13th in the world. In the second round, he will face Hong Kong’s Lee Cheuk Yiu, who caused a major upset in the opening round by defeating sixth seed Christo Popov.

Meanwhile, in another men’s singles match, India’s Ayush Shetty also delivered an impressive performance to progress further in the tournament. Ayush defeated Malaysia’s Lee Zii Jia in straight games, winning 21-12, 21-17. His dominant display against a strong opponent has been one of the notable results of the opening round.

Ayush Shetty now faces a tough challenge in the second round, where he will take on China’s world No. 1 player Shi Yu Qi, making his upcoming match one of the most anticipated encounters for Indian badminton fans.
